Confederate (CSV)

Private

Burrell Thomas Jones

"B.T."

(1843 - 1893)

Home State: Georgia

Branch of Service: Infantry

Unit: 10th Georgia Infantry

Before Sharpsburg

He enlisted in Company A, 10th Georgia Infantry as Private on 10 May 1861.

On the Campaign

He was captured in action on 17 September 1862 at Sharpsburg.

The rest of the War

Paroled by the Federal Provost Marshal at Keedysville, MD on 20 September 1862. He was wounded and captured in action in the Wilderness, VA on 6 May 1864. By 8 June he was at the Old Capitol Prison, Washington DC. On 23 July 1864 he was among the first sent to Elmira Prison, NY, and was there until paroled on 19 May 1865.

After the War

He was a carpenter and car builder in Chattanooga, TN.

References & notes

Basic information from Fincham's Roster1, which lists him as B.F. Jones. Details from great great grandson Thomas A. Bowman, citing service records. His gravesite is on Findagrave.

Birth

1843 in GA

Death

08/24/1893; Chattanooga, TN; burial in Citizens Cemetery, Chattanooga, TN
